Takeoffs & Landings by Leighton Collins This is a classic aviation book by the founder of Air Facts Magazine started back in 1938. Leighton Collins was a pioneer in aviation and a master aviator. His book, Takeoffs & Landings, covers these Crucial Maneuvers and Everything in Between,
